So last night when I became aware of the vibrations, I tried something new. A key to exit is raising your vibrations, and a lot of people say to try rolling out of their body. I hadn't tried that yet, but I decided to take that idea a step further. I spun in circles as fast as I could. It wasn't dizzying in any way. It felt incredible. The best description I can give is raising the torque of an engine. It felt like I was sucking in more and more... power. I began rising straight out of my body, and on top of that, I could SEE. We have 360 degree vision anyway, so it didn't look like I was spinning, you know? Anyway, it felt like I was about to have a great projection, when......
My girlfriend kicked me in her sleep. ARRRRRRRRRRRRRRRRRR!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
